Output 584588ff60d0416ce9cb96ca45e3f94045ea740e2bd09f621e01e024c46517d9:15

value
1558000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f2728e77a9e1a82e5326a8759cb4d2fff527ba OP_EQUAL
address
3B5MHf4r7afJ5xaZtJxYBdBZpqyJiSLfri
transaction
584588ff60d0416ce9cb96ca45e3f94045ea740e2bd09f621e01e024c46517d9